REGN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

1,291 of the 7,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als (REGN)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$59.1B — down 11% from $66.7B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 147 funds closed out of REGN and 139 opened new positions — a net loss of 8 holders — while 453 trimmed existing stakes and 528 added.

The largest buyer was Two Sigma Advisers, opening a new position worth an estimated $381M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$964M.
